1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a vector?

Back

A vector is a quantity that has both magnitude and direction, represented graphically by an arrow.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you calculate the magnitude of a vector represented as ?

Back

Magnitude = √(x² + y²) where x and y are the components of the vector.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the direction of a vector ?

Back

Direction = tan⁻¹(y/x) (adjusted based on the quadrant of the vector).

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the horizontal and vertical components of a vector with magnitude |v| and angle θ?

Back

Horizontal component = |v| * cos(θ), Vertical component = |v| * sin(θ).

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you find the angle of a vector in standard position?

Back

The angle θ can be found using θ = tan⁻¹(y/x) and adjusting for the correct quadrant.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the formula for the dot product of two vectors and ?

Back

Dot product = a*c + b*d.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the significance of the dot product being zero?

Back

If the dot product of two vectors is zero, the vectors are orthogonal (perpendicular to each other).
